What is dental scaling and polishing?
Dental scaling and polishing, as described by Dr. Punit H. Thawani and his associates, is a professional dental cleaning procedure aimed at removing plaque, tartar, and stains from your teeth. Scaling targets deposits along and below the gumline, while polishing smooths the tooth surfaces, making them stain-free and easier to keep clean. This treatment prevents gum disease while keeping your smile fresh and sparkling.
Why is dental scaling and polishing important?
Scaling and polishing are considered crucial because they reach areas your toothbrush and floss cannot always access. Over time, plaque hardens into tartar, which cannot be removed by regular brushing. Left untreated, this often leads to gum disease and bad breath, and can even affect your overall health. Regular cleaning helps keep your teeth and gums in top condition.
Does dental scaling and polishing hurt?
No, the procedure is generally comfortable. Some of our patients may notice a slight sensation or mild discomfort, especially if they have sensitive gums or significant tartar buildup. How often should I get dental scaling and polishing?
Most of our dentists recommend having this procedure every six months as part of your regular dental check-up. However, your specific needs may vary depending on your oral hygiene habits, diet, and overall dental health.
Will it make my teeth whiter?
While dental scaling and polishing are not the same as whitening, the procedure does help remove surface stains caused by food and drink, leaving your teeth noticeably cleaner and brighter. How can I maintain the results at home?
To keep your smile looking great between visits, you should practice good oral hygiene at home. Brush your teeth at least twice a day using fluoride toothpaste, floss daily, and maintain a balanced diet low in sugar. Staying hydrated also promotes a healthy mouth.
